Beyond simple appreciation, the concept of staking has emerged as a powerful engine for passive income within the crypto space. Many blockchain networks, particularly those utilizing a Proof-of-Stake (PoS) consensus mechanism, allow you to "stake" your holdings – essentially locking them up to support the network's operations. In return, you are rewarded with newly minted coins or transaction fees. This process is akin to earning interest in a savings account, but with potentially much higher yields. Platforms and protocols offer various staking opportunities, from locking your assets for a fixed period to flexible staking options. The allure of earning a passive income simply by holding onto your digital assets is undeniable, making staking a cornerstone of many crypto earnings strategies.

Another fascinating DeFi application is liquidity provision. Decentralized exchanges (DEXs) rely on users to provide pools of trading pairs (e.g., ETH/USDC) to facilitate trades. In return for providing this liquidity, you earn a share of the trading fees generated by the exchange. While this comes with risks, such as impermanent loss, the potential for earning substantial rewards, especially during periods of high trading volume, makes it an attractive option for those willing to understand and manage the associated risks.

The realm of yield farming takes DeFi earning a step further. This strategy involves moving your crypto assets between different DeFi protocols to maximize returns. It often involves depositing assets into lending protocols, then using the interest earned or the borrowed assets to stake in other protocols, or provide liquidity, thereby earning multiple streams of income. Yield farming can be complex and requires constant monitoring of market conditions and protocol changes, but for the savvy investor, it can offer some of the highest returns in the crypto space. Cryptocurrency trading is perhaps the most widely recognized active earning strategy. This involves buying and selling cryptocurrencies with the aim of profiting from price fluctuations. Trading can range from short-term strategies like day trading or swing trading, where positions are held for minutes, hours, or days, to longer-term position trading. Success in trading hinges on a deep understanding of market dynamics, technical analysis (studying price charts and patterns), and fundamental analysis (evaluating the underlying value of an asset). It’s a skill that requires discipline, emotional control, and a commitment to continuous learning, as the crypto markets are known for their rapid and often unpredictable movements.

Beyond speculative trading, arbitrage opportunities present a more calculated approach to profit. Arbitrage involves exploiting price differences for the same asset on different exchanges. For instance, if Bitcoin is trading at $30,000 on Exchange A and $30,100 on Exchange B, an arbitrage trader can buy Bitcoin on Exchange A and simultaneously sell it on Exchange B, pocketing the $100 difference (minus fees). While these discrepancies are often small and can be fleeting, the efficiency of automated trading bots can capture these opportunities systematically. This strategy generally carries lower risk than traditional trading but requires quick execution and access to multiple trading platforms.

At its core, blockchain is a distributed, immutable ledger. Imagine a shared digital notebook, replicated across thousands, even millions, of computers worldwide. Every transaction, every piece of data, is recorded as a "block," and each new block is cryptographically linked to the previous one, forming a "chain." This makes the ledger incredibly secure and transparent. No single entity can alter or delete information once it's been added, fostering a level of trust that traditional financial systems often struggle to achieve. Consider the potential for fractional ownership made possible by blockchain. Through tokenization, illiquid assets like real estate, fine art, or even intellectual property can be divided into smaller, tradable units. This allows a wider range of investors to participate in asset classes previously out of reach, and for owners, it provides a new way to unlock liquidity and earn from their holdings without selling the entire asset. For example, you might earn rental income from a fraction of a commercial property, or royalties from a tokenized music album, all managed and distributed via blockchain. This democratizes investment and unlocks dormant value, creating new earning streams from assets that were once static.
